Description:
-
The tripod of creativity, innovation, and entrepreneurship are the foundation of the successful organization. The encouragement, management, and culture to promote an innovative work environment places specific demands on leadership. After an exploration of popular innovation theory, organizations and companies whose novel adoptions have transformed their contexts and industries will be identified, discussed, and evaluated. Lessons for tomorrow's leaders will be inferred.
